Key Features:
- Configurable for Flexibility: The GE Proteus XR/a offers clinical flexibility to accommodate different imaging needs.
- Exceptional Image Quality: Delivers high-quality images while ensuring dose efficiency.
- Convenient Patient Positioning: The four-way floating tabletop allows for optimal patient positioning.
- Adjustable Overhead Tube Support: Easily transitions between off-table and upright radiography configurations, supporting a range of patient scenarios.
- Effortless Operation: Designed for smooth maneuverability, with one or two-handed operation and front/rear foot control pedals.
- Space-Saving Design: Requires minimal room preparation, allowing for simple integration into existing facility layouts.
- Enhanced Accessibility: The patient-side design facilitates quick adjustments, reducing the need for staff to make frequent trips to the control room.
- Added Safety: Cushioned tabletop bumpers minimize the risk of injury from sharp corners.
- Comfort-Focused: Adjustable table height improves patient comfort during examinations.
- Precision X-Ray Production: Features a three-phase, high-frequency generator that self-calibrates for consistent, dose-efficient exposures.
- Advanced Control System: Microprocessor-controlled settings ensure consistent image quality, while a high-speed x-ray tube offers various focal spots.
- User-Friendly Touchscreen: High-resolution touchscreen technology displays all relevant technique factors simultaneously, including kV, mAs, SID, and angle.
- Anatomical Programming: Organized by morphology or body region, simplifying the imaging process.
- Auto-Collimating Functionality: Incorporates cassette-size sensing trays for improved accuracy.
- Tomo Module: Easily sets up for high-quality linear tomography, enhancing imaging versatility.
